Food Security and Livelihood Sector Manager at Action Against Hunger


Action Against Hunger is the world’s hunger specialist and leader in a global movement that aims to end life-threatening hunger for good within our lifetimes. For 40 years, the humanitarian and development organization has been on the front lines, treating and preventing hunger across nearly 50 countries. It served more than 21 million people in 2018 alone.

Job Title: Food Security and Livelihood Sector Manager

Location: Maiduguri, Borno
Employment Type: Full time
Department: Programmes - FSL
Experience: Manager / Supervisor
Starting date: As Soon As Possible
Direct Line Manager: Area Manager

Objective 1

  • Provide technical lead and guidance in the implementation of FSL activities of the program.

Tasks and Responsibilities:

  • Develop detailed planning and implementation strategies for kitchen garden, farmers field school and other agricultural activities related components of the program in collaboration with the SPM and technical guidance of the FSL Head of Department.
  • Evaluate and update project needs (HR, financing, logistics).
  • Elaborate appropriate questionnaires and apply the follow-up and supervision tools of the project
  • Identify and inform the SPM of any problems or constraints.
  • Ensure follow-up of the project’s progress and write suitable reports.
  • Propose solutions and improvements concerning the project’s progress.
  • Coordinate activities and sensitize local partners in the field.
  • Develop detailed planning and implementation strategies for Cash based Transfer, Social Protection  activities in collaboration with the SPM and guidance from the FSL technical team.
  • Develop detailed planning and implementation strategies for economic strengthening of the income generation activities of the households in collaboration SPM and guidance from the FSL technical team.
  • Compile monthly FSL program technical reports with an overview of activities of the program, contextual updates, and quantitative indicator follow-up and submit to SPM for consolidation.

Position Requirements
Qualification:

  • Degree in FSL related studies e.g. agriculture, social sciences, peace building, business, economics or other related field, etc.
  • Minimum of three (3) years’ work experience in implementing food security and livelihood projects.

Essential:

  • Experience in managerial position.
  • Capacity to supervise a team.
  • Good knowledge of  techniques and agricultural production systems.  
  • Good knowledge of implementing projects in insecure contexts.
  • Computer knowledge (Word, Excel and Microsoft outlook).
  • Experience in social protection, Cash for Work, Income Generating Activities and other livelihood programming.

Preferred:

  • Good knowledge of the intervention area/s and local economy.
  • Previous experience with AAH.
  • Previous development programming experience.
  • Capacity to write high quality reports.
  • Previous team management and activity planning experience.
